Tanner Ta Ta Foundation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2014 | 62,128 | 38,904 | 23,224 | 18.5 | — |
| 2015 | 60,739 | 50,648 | 10,091 | 16.6 | — |
| 2016 | 41,469 | 49,417 | −7,948 | 15.1 | — |
| 2017 | 55,680 | 41,853 | 13,827 | 21.8 | — |
| 2018 | 36,318 | 53,807 | −17,489 | 12.5 | — |
| 2019 | 32,987 | 39,398 | −6,411 | 8.5 | — |
| 2020 | 30,415 | 24,899 | 5,516 | 16.2 | — |
In its most recent public year (2020), this organization brought in $5,516 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 16.2 months of spending, down from 18.5 in 2014.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2020.
